Probe at Jupiter

Seeing Stars

Available for over a year

Latest discoveries from the Galileo mission which gathers data from Jupiter and its moons - discussion with Steve Miller of University College, London. How a star is born with star formation specialist Anneila Sargent of California Institute of Technology. Plus what was happening among the stars and planets in February 2000. This is a programme from the BBC World Service Archive and was originally broadcast in 2000.
